Rebel Wilson worried she'll be banned from top hotels after New Year's Eve fireball

Written by . Published: January 22 2015

Actress Rebel Wilson is begging friends who attended her New Year's Eve party in Sydney, Australia not to release footage online because she fears she'll be banned from leading hotel chains if bosses see the extent of the damage she caused in her suite when a sparkler stunt got out of hand.


The Pitch Perfect star was ringing in the New Year at the Park Hyatt with pals like Matt Lucas and Hugh Sheridan when she sparked a "fireball" by suggesting they light 50 sparklers at the same time.


Wilson admits in hindsight it was a terrible idea because it burned one pal and caused damage in the suite.


She tells Aussie radio hosts Kyle and Jackie O, "We kind of trashed the hotel room.


"I thought it would be a funny idea to set 50 (sparklers) alight at once... on the balcony. Don’t do it at home because it causes a huge fireball."


Wilson reveals a nearby ice bucket helped limit the damage to the room, and she has offered to pay for the clean-up - but now she worries that someone might leak the footage of the fireball incident.
